A portable power station is a compact, rechargeable energy storage device that provides instant AC/DC power for a wide range of devices, making it indispensable for camping, road trips, RV adventures, and emergency power outages. Unlike traditional generators, it operates silently, emits no fumes, and requires minimal maintenance, relying on lithium-ion battery technology for high energy density and lightweight portability (typically 5-20kg, depending on capacity).
Equipped with multiple output ports—including AC sockets (for laptops, mini-fridges, or power tools), USB-A/C ports (for smartphones, tablets, and cameras), and DC ports (for car accessories or LED lights)—it caters to diverse charging needs. Capacities range from 200Wh to 2000Wh or more; mid-range models can power a mini-fridge for 8-12 hours or a smartphone 20+ times. Most units support multiple recharging methods: via AC wall outlet, car cigarette lighter, or compatible solar panels (enabling off-grid solar charging).
Safety features are paramount, with built-in protections against overcurrent, overvoltage, short circuits, and overheating. The intuitive LCD display shows remaining battery life, input/output status, and charging speed.
